Your Responsibilities: Safety Coordinator
Support the Safety Manager in implementing and maintaining safety programs that comply with local state and federal regulations.
  • Safety Standards & Regulations: Remain well versed on safety standards applicable to our industry and company needs. Inform and train managers and employees on safety requirements based on these regulations.
  • Incident Management: Investigate workplace incidents to determine root causes and recommend preventative measures. Help to modify job or work as needed. Train the employee on safe work practices
  • Site Inspections: Conduct regular field safety audits and inspections to identify and mitigate potential hazards. Propose and implement solutions and follow-up on corrective actions
  • Safety Training: Develop and deliver employee safety training specifically Lock Out training on CNC metalworking or other industrial manufacturing equipment Fall Safety etc.
  • Safety Equipment & PPE: Recommend necessary personal protective equipment based on the requirements of each role. i.e. lock out kits fall protection gear Arc Flash kits. lifting straps AEDs etc.
  • Documentation & Third-Party Systems: Maintain accurate safety records. Assist with maintaining third-party pre-qualification systems (Avetta Browz ISN etc.)
What Were Looking For: Safety Coordinator
  • Experience:3-6 years in a safety-related role preferably in a machine shop or metal manufacturing setting. Experience conducting safety training LOTO fall safety etc. Experience administering third-party pre-qualification sites.
  • Knowledge:Familiarity with OSHA 29 CFR 1910 General Industry regulations NFPA 70E standards and ANSI guidelines
  • Skills:Strong communication abilities to conduct training and present complex information effectively
  • Attributes:Analytical mindset attention to detail and a proactive approach to safety
  • Requirements:Valid drivers license with a clean driving record and the flexibility to travel as needed
